Childrens Bunk Beds

Bunk beds are a great way to allow children to share one room without having to sacrifice the floor space. This lets them have more space for physical play and enables siblings to live in harmony!

When choosing a bunk bed, it's important to take into account your child's age and level of physical development. Find bunk beds that have guardrails on the top and a sturdy staircase or ladder.

Space-saving

Bunk beds can maximize the space in a children's room, allowing more space to games. They also cost less than two twin-sized beds. This makes them an affordable option for families with several children. Bunks that have trundle beds, which can accommodate a third mattress with casters beneath the bunk on the bottom, can be even more cost-effective for families with a large number of children.

Bunk beds are a popular choice among kids because they're unique and enjoyable. They also offer the perfect opportunity to create lasting memories, whether with your friends or siblings. Sharing beds with siblings is a great way to strengthen relationships between them, as it teaches cooperation and responsibility.

Some bunk beds for children include built-in storage like shelves and drawers. They can be extremely convenient for kids to keep their books, clothing toys, and other things in. This is a great method to teach your children how to get rid of things when they are done using them.

It's not a requirement that children must sleep on the top bunk. However, it is recommended to wait until they're six years of age to be able to demonstrate the mental and physical development necessary to be able safely sleep on the upper bunk. It's important to remember that young kids might not be comfortable climbing up and down the ladder, and children who struggle with coordination might struggle to sleep in the higher beds. It is best to follow the Consumer Product Safety Commission recommendations to ensure your children's safety. Also, make sure to use a sturdy, durable ladder and safety rails for the highest bunk. Safety

Although bunk beds have risks, they can be secured by following the right rules and practical measures. Parents must remind their children regularly of these rules since they tend to forget them as they grow older. This is important, especially when children are invited by friends to sleepover. They might not be familiar with the rules.

Injuries that result from bunk beds can range from minor bruises and bumps to brain bleeds and concussions which are serious medical conditions that require emergency treatment. A bed that collapses could cause serious injuries, since it can trap children or cause them to fall on the hard surface. Bunk beds that are built in accordance with national safety standards can help prevent these injuries. Also, make sure your children are aware of the dangers and how to avoid them.

Make sure the bunks have guardrails on both sides and that the gaps are no greater than 3.5 inches to avoid strangulation. It's also important to keep the bunks clear from hanging ceiling fans or lighting fixtures and to install a nightlight near the ladder for late-night bathroom trips. It's also an excellent idea to let children use the ladder to climb into and out of their beds, rather than chairs or other furniture.
